2/9: Why Is Thought Fragmentary?

What is the nature of thought?

Why has thought divided you and me, we and they?

Why has thought invented ideals?

The interference of the observer, who is the past, prevents a radical change of ‘what is’.

Our consciousness is full of the things of thought and is fragmentary.

Is there a consciousness that is not fragmentary?

Thought as knowledge has its right place, but it has no place in the psyche.

Can the mind, the whole structure of the psyche, cease to be?


Questions from the audience followed the talk

The Krishnamurti Collection is an official podcast by Krishnamurti Foundation Trust.

Across this wide selection of events, Krishnamurti explores fundamental questions of human existence that touch our daily lives and relationships. Each episode of the podcast features a full-length Krishnamurti recording from the Foundation’s archives, with a new series released every week.

Krishnamurti is widely regarded as one of the greatest philosophers and teachers of all time. For seven decades, he spoke to large audiences around the world, as well as with notable individuals and small groups. Krishnamurti stressed that ‘There is hope in humanity, not in society, not in systems, not in organised religious systems, but in you and in me.’

Established by Krishnamurti in 1968, Krishnamurti Foundation Trust is a non-profit charity based at Brockwood Park in the UK, which is also home to The Krishnamurti Centre and Brockwood Park School. To learn more about our activities and retreat programmes, and to donate, please visit:
